Boulder Beach joins Silverwood Theme Park in opening on Saturday

Silverwood Theme Park and Boulder Beach are opening on May 30 during Phase 3 of Idaho's reopening plan.

ATHOL, Idaho — With sun and temperatures hovering near 90 degrees in the forecast, Silverwood Theme Park has decided to open Boulder Beach on Saturday. 

Avalanche Mountain, Ricochet Rapids, Toddler Springs and the Cabanas will not reopen this weekend. The water park was initially slated to open on Saturday, June 6. 

The theme park is also opening on May 30 during Phase 3 of Idaho's reopening plan. It will operate at a controlled, reduced capacity to maintain social distancing guidelines.

Daily operations for both parks will begin on Saturday, June 6. 

All tickets sold will be reservation only and require people to select the date of their visit. The number of tickets that will be sold for a specific date will be limited. 

The configuration of lines will also look different to allow for social distancing between families. As the park's overall capacity will be reduced, lines for attractions may appear longer than normal. 

Silverwood leaders say the park has also added a sanitation wipe down procedure between ride cycles.

Masks aren't required in the park, but Silverwood will provide them for guests who want one. In eating areas, tables will be spread out and plexiglass barriers will be in place.

Season passes that are not used by Sept. 27, 2020, will automatically roll over to the 2021 season, Silverwood previously said on its website. The expiration date for people who are unable to use their passes this season will be rolled over to Sept. 26, 2021. 

Those who do use their season passes this summer will receive a special discounted rate if they choose to renew their passes in 2021.

Those who pre-purchased one or two-day tickets during the 2020 season will receive an additional day in 2021. If you have pre-purchased 3-day tickets for the 2020 season, and aren't able to use them this year, Silverwood will turn your tickets into a 2021 season pass.
